Although a walkover means that a scheduled match ends up with a winner and a loser, this does not apply to your bets. If the walkover match was part of a multiple bet though, the rest of the bet will remain intact only with this line removed, impacting the final payout but at least not bringing down the whole wager. You are more likely to see walkover results in the early stages of cup competitions, especially those involving teams low down the footballing pyramid. This does not always end up in the opposition receiving a walkover win though, often the match is simply replayed. Oftentimes, walkovers happen when a player suffers an injury while warming up, or feels seriously unwell in between matches, or has aggravated a pre-existing injury to a point that prevents them from recovering in time for their next match.
